Pros

Good people, Good discounts. Great place to learn and work on cool projects. Lots of philanthropy efforts made my company that you can get involved in.

Cons

Management is top heavy and rude. It takes forever to get a decision finalize. Deadline expectations are unrealistic. Don't expect a good salary, good work life balance or a reasonable raise...ever. Moving up takes blood, sweat and a lot of tears.
